Mental Health Support Worker
Are you a compassionate and dedicated individual with CPI/MAPA training, looking for flexible opportunities in social care? Join our team and make a meaningful difference supporting adults with challenging behaviours in specialist supported living services.
Hourly Rate: £12.30 – £12.60 per hour
What you’ll do:
• Support adults with daily living tasks, including personal care, meals, and household routines
• Provide emotional support, companionship, and promote overall well-being
• Administer medication safely and in line with care plans
• Use CPI/MAPA behaviour management techniques to maintain safety and dignity
• Encourage independence and engagement in daily and community activities
Requirements:
• Valid CPI/MAPA training certificate
• Experience supporting adults with challenging behaviour
• Strong interpersonal and communication skills
• Empathetic, patient, and proactive approach
• Flexible to work evenings, weekends, and bank holidays
• Confident in using hoists when required
